HOLY MAKAR SANKRANTI

The solar calendar is used for determining the Sun’s position and all things related.Our horoscopes and most festivals are determined by the lunar calendar; while a few are determined by the solar calendar. Sankranti is the day when the Sun transitions from one Zodiac sign into the other. Makar Sankranti is believed to be the most auspicious of all Sankrantis. This is the day when the Sun moves from the Zodiac sign Sagittarius into Capricorn.

Because Makar Sankranti is determined by the solar calendar, it always falls on 14/15th January. It marks the end of the khar maas and heralds the beginning of the auspicious days. This festival is known by different names in different states. It may be called Magh Bihu, Pongal, Maghi, Shishur Saenkraat, Suggi Habba, etc.

The Sun is the most visible devta that showers us with heat and light everyday. Sunlight is most important for our wellbeing as well as for plants because if there is no sunlight even the plants cannot perform photosynthesis. So if there was no sun, there would be no food. And if there was no food, nothing could survive on the earth. It is awe inspiring to reflect upon how silently, the Earth transitions from one Rashi (zodiac sign) into the next. It’s also inspiring to note how diligently and silently the Sun rises everyday and showers its benevolence on us all. This is in stark contrast to how humans operate. If they give ten rupees to someone, they announce it to ten people.
